Default Amp?

I have a 95 318ti, i was wondering if it has an amp stock... i cant seem to find one but you never know, so as of now i am pretty sure it is a no but if anyone knows different let me know, thanks

hi there. Stock amp? as in can you replace it with an aftermarket unit? this answer is a def. no. I'm assuming you have the so-called 10 speaker system.
I won't go into a huge reason why but basically the amp, located in the rear driver side trunk area, is an amp with a built-in crossovers which splits the signal to the 10 speakers independently. No amp does that.
I've been debating on upgrading the system but its a major undertaking.
replace head unit
replace all speakers
replace amp

You can read my recent post on a custom built Ti Subwoofer which will greatly enhance the sound. if you looking for an ipod option there is none.

There was a wiring harness set up in the trunk of my old ti (also a '95, but without the premium sound system) but the previous owner had BMW replace the stock head unit and cd changer with a pioneer unit, so they may have removed it. Look behind the grey carpet on the drivers side in the trunk area. That's where the stock wires were.

He said he has a 95, so I'm not sure (could be wrong) if he has the 10 speaker setup, I'm not even sure if it was available in that year (all 95's I've seen have the 6 speaker set up). I don't know what your question was posted for, azs318ti, but if it's to change out the head unit... you shouldn't have to mess with amps etc... you would only need to get an appropriate wiring harness. However, if you're planning on speaker upgrades, just like ScnStlr said, it will probably be a huge job in replacing amps and speakers (meaning expensive). According to BMW, in 1995 the Premium audio system was available as an option on the 318ti. Option #676, cost $500.
